WESTINGHOUSE 5X00105G01 Ovation Base Module

The WESTINGHOUSE 5X00105G01 is a foundational hardware component within the Ovation Distributed Control System (DCS) architecture. Functioning as a base module or system platform card, it provides the critical physical and electrical infrastructure required to host and interconnect intelligent controller and communication modules within an Ovation chassis. This module is not a processor itself but an essential enabler, forming the reliable backbone upon which the system's computational and I/O capabilities are built, ensuring stable operation in power plants and large-scale industrial facilities.


Primary Function and Role

This module acts as the primary carrier board within a designated Ovation controller or network chassis slot. Its core function is to provide a standardized platform with a high-density connector system (backplane interface) onto which a primary processor module (such as a 1C31179G02) or a key communication interface card is mounted. The 5X00105G01 facilitates all essential connections between the hosted module and the chassis backplane, including power distribution, high-speed data bus access, and system clock signals. It essentially translates the chassis's backplane resources into a form factor and pinout specifically designed for a particular class of Ovation controller or gateway module, ensuring optimal signal integrity and reliability.


Key Features and Design Attributes

  • Platform for Critical Modules: Serves as the dedicated mounting and interconnection platform for high-performance Ovation controller or communication processor modules.

  • High-Signal-Integrity Design: Engineered with controlled impedance traces and robust connectors to maintain signal quality for high-speed data buses between the module and the system backplane.

  • Integrated Power Regulation: Often includes localized voltage regulation and filtering circuitry to provide clean, stable power to the mounted processor card from the chassis's main supply.

  • System Management Interface: May host controllers for chassis management functions, such as monitoring slot-specific health, facilitating hot-swap logic, and reporting status to the DCS software.

  • Robust Mechanical Construction: Built with a durable PCB and reinforced mounting points to securely support heavier processor modules and withstand vibration in industrial environments.

  • Diagnostic and Status Indicators: Features LED indicators for power, activity, and fault conditions related to the base platform and the module it hosts.

Application and System Context

The 5X00105G01 is exclusively used within Ovation DCS cabinets. It is a mandatory component in configurations requiring specific high-end controllers or network gateways. You will find this base module in:

  • Main Controller Chassis: Forming the foundation for primary process controllers in power plant boiler or turbine control systems.

  • Network Coordination Chassis: Serving as the platform for network interface modules that manage communication between different system segments.

  • System Expansion Units: Enabling the addition of powerful processing nodes to an existing Ovation system for enhanced control capacity.

Its proper operation is transparent to the end-user but is absolutely critical for the stability of the module it supports.


Installation and Maintenance

Installation involves carefully seating the 5X00105G01 into its designated chassis slot and ensuring it is firmly connected to the backplane. The compatible processor module is then installed onto this base card. Maintenance is typically passive, relying on the module's diagnostic LEDs for health indication. Any failure usually requires replacement of the base module and/or the processor card as a unit or matched pair, following strict ESD and hot-swap procedures where applicable.
